What is a Data Hub?

A Data Hub is a centralized platform that helps gather, manage and distribute data from various sources. It is a key component of a modern data architecture, offering a consolidated view of information and facilitating its accessibility and use by the company’s various business lines while guaranteeing its security and compliance.

Data Hub fundamentals

The operation of a Data Hub is based on several basic principles:

  • Data integration: Able to ingest structured and unstructured data from multiple internal or external sources.
  • Data governance: Ensures rigorous control over the quality and consistency of data, as well as their compliance with laws and regulations.
  • Data storage : Offers a flexible and scalable storage solution to accommodate volumetric data growth.
  • Data distribution: Enables the delivery of data to the systems and users who need it.
  • Analytics: Integrates data analysis tools to enable decision-making based on valuable insights.

A Data Hub should be designed to support a wide range of use cases and be agile enough to adapt to technological developments and changing business needs.

The advantages of a Data Hub

Implementing a Data Hub has several key benefits:

  • Centralization: Provides a unified view of data, simplifying management and access to it.
  • Agility: Provides a flexible platform to quickly respond to changing market demands and strategic business initiatives.
  • Security : Strengthens data security with appropriate access controls and protection measures.
  • Compliance : Helps comply with various data regulations, such as GDPR (General Data Protection Regulation).
  • Data analysis : Allows the deployment of advanced analytics tools, thus contributing to data valorization.

The key benefits of data hubs for businesses

THE data hubs, or centralized data platforms, have become a major asset for businesses of all sizes. Capable of integrating, managing and distributing data efficiently, they provide benefits that can transform an organization’s IT landscape.

Centralization and accessibility of data

The first benefit of a data hub is the centralization information from different sources. This allows for a single place where data is stored, managed and from which it can be easily accessed by authorized users. This centralization results in better data consistency, thereby reducing duplicates and synchronization errors.

Improved data quality

Data hubs promotequality assurance by establishing processes that maintain data integrity. Indeed, they can include mechanisms for data cleaning, deduplication, and other forms of validation, ensuring that the company relies on reliable data to make its decisions.

Data Governance and Compliance

There data governance is essential to comply with regulations and maintain customer and partner trust. Data hubs offer systems that help comply with data privacy and security policies, such as the General Data Protection Regulation (GDPR) in Europe.

Better real-time data management

In a world where decisions must be made quickly, the ability to manage data in real time is crucial. Data hubs make it possible to capture and analyze live information, giving businesses the ability to react immediately to changing situations.

Integration with advanced analytics tools

Data hubs can easily integrate with data management toolsadvanced analysis and Business Intelligence (BI). This gives companies an in-depth view of their operations and facilitates decision-making based on concrete and analyzed data.

Improved internal and external collaboration

Data hubs improve collaboration by facilitating data sharing between different departments or with external partners. This encourages innovation and enables more consistent implementation of business strategies across diverse teams.

Optimization of costs and resources

By consolidating data storage and management needs, data hubs enable businesses to realize significant savings. It also helps to optimize resources IT through better allocation of storage space and computing power.

Preparing for the evolution of information systems

Data hubs make businesses more agile in the face of technological developments. By having a scalable platform, businesses can integrate new applications and services more easily, thereby remaining competitive in an ever-changing digital environment.

Strengthening the competitive position

Finally, by making the most of the data available to them, companies can strengthen their competitive position. Data hubs provide actionable insights that can lead to the identification of new market opportunities and the improvement of product or service offerings.

Architecture and main components of a Data Hub

The term Data Hub refers to a data management architecture designed to manage, process, and distribute large volumes of data from a variety of sources. As a central part of an enterprise data strategy, a Data Hub facilitates data access, integration, sharing and analysis. Let’s discover together the components and architecture that underlie a Data Hub.

General architecture of a Data Hub

The architecture of a Data Hub is designed to provide flexibility and scalability in data management. It is made up of several distinct layers:

  • The data integration layer: It ensures the collection of data from different sources, whether databases, cloud services or IoT (Internet of Things) devices.
  • The data processing layer: This layer includes the tools and processes needed to clean, transform, and consolidate data into a standardized, usable format.
  • The data storage layer: At the heart of the Data Hub, it is used to store data in a structured and secure manner, often in data lakes or data warehouses.
  • The data management layer: She is responsible for data governance, quality and security, ensuring that data remains reliable and complies with current regulations.
  • The data distribution layer: It allows the distribution of processed and stored data to downstream systems, such as analytical platforms or business applications.

Main components of a Data Hub

A Data Hub comprises several essential components, each performing a specific function:

  1. The database management system (DBMS): It is used to manage databases where data is organized, stored and queried.
  2. ETL tools (Extract, Transform, Load): These software are used to extract data from different sources, transform them according to business needs and load them into the storage system.
  3. The data warehouse: It is a centralized data warehouse where structured data is stored in a standardized format.
  4. The data lake: It is a data storage that can hold large amounts of raw data, in their native formats, until it is needed.
  5. Data governance solutions: These solutions help the company manage the availability, usability, integrity and security of its data.
  6. The analytical platform: It supports data analysis and business intelligence tools, allowing organizations to derive insights from their data.
  7. APIs (Application Programming Interfaces): Programming interfaces allow the Data Hub to be integrated with other systems and data flows to be automated.

Implementation and best practices for Data Hubs

Data Hub strategic planning

A successful implementation begins with thorough planning. Identifying your company’s specific needs and key objectives is essential. Things to consider include data governance, compliance rules, and security and privacy aspects.

Choosing the Appropriate Technology

The market offers a variety of technological solutions for Data Hubs. Choosing the most suitable platform depends on several factors: volume of data, compatibility with existing systems, and ability to evolve. Solutions like Azure, AWS, or Google Cloud Platform are often favored for their robustness and flexibility.

Data modeling and structure

Effective data modeling is essential. It must be designed to allow easy integration of data from various sources. In addition, the structure must be designed to support future developments without disrupting the existing data ecosystem.

Data integration

Data integration is perhaps the most critical aspect of setting up a Data Hub. This is the ability of the system to collect data from different sources, clean it, transform it and load it (ETL process) in a reliable and secure manner.

Data governance and quality

Data governance ensures that all managed information meets high quality standards and remains compliant with current regulations. This includes implementing policies defining who has access to what, how data is used and shared.

Data Hub Security

Securing your Data Hub is a top priority. Security best practices include encrypting data, both at rest and in transit, and implementing authentication and authorization systems to control access to data.

Monitoring and maintenance

Once your Data Hub in place, continuous monitoring is necessary to ensure its proper functioning. This includes performance monitoring, regular updates and proactive maintenance to prevent potential failures.

Training and user involvement

End-user engagement is crucial to maximizing the effectiveness of a Data Hub. Relevant training and implementing a data-centric culture are key elements for users to take full advantage of the Data Hub’s capabilities.

THE Data Hubs are a vital component in a company’s data management strategy. Following best practices and careful implementation ensures your organization reaps the benefits of better data integration, easier access to information and informed decision-making.
